Value of Platelet-Rich Plasma in Post Severe Acute Respiratory Syndrome Coronavirus 2
NaSingle-groupOpen-labelTreatment
Summary
The study will be conducted to evaluate : The efficacy of Platelet Rich plasma in treatment of smell disorders post severe acute respiratory syndrome coronavirus 2 (SARS-CoV-2) via the growth factors involved in accelerating and enhancing healing.
